This first quarter has been full of new vision, projects, and leadership. Perhaps the most notable of acknowledgements is the retirement of Bill Huston, Huston & Company’s founder (and my father). The shop was cleaned up, lights were hung, artistic charcuterie covered the workbenches, glasses clanged, and speeches shared to honor Bill Huston for his 35+ years of creation, connection, and dedication to and for Huston & Company. During that night his legacy was notably passed on. In the days, months, and probably years to come, Bill will continue to be a part of the shop in advisory and consultant roles. Huston & Company was so much more to him than merely a job or career. For those who know him or have had the opportunity to work or interact with him it was very clear that Huston & Company was a passion, and although he has officially retired I have no doubt that this passion will continue to thrive and bud into new and exciting opportunities for the company and for him personally. Since we opened the doors to our furniture workshop in 1988, Huston & Company has remained committed to its founding mission: to design and build furniture that integrates function, form, and master-level craftsmanship in a style that is elegant, graceful, and enduring.
The hope with our newsletters is to keep you updated with the recent designs, projects, and people that keep us inspired and creating. Our shop focuses on two main categories of furniture: Institutions (Academic, Library, Corporate) and Residential.
